SA land in Zim to be protected

SA is on the verge of signing an agreement to protect the rights of South African landowners in Zimbabwe.

Trade and Industry Minister Mandisi Mpahlwa said the agreement with Zimbabwe would allow SA investors to take legal action if their property was expropriated, an SABC News report says. They would also be allowed to refer any investment related dispute to international arbitration. Zimbabwe officials said land already seized from South Africans might be returned once its land reform programme was complete. Full report on SABC News site
